HIP 23309

HIP 23309 is a star cataloged in modern stellar databases.

Located approximately 87.3 light-years from Earth, HIP 23309 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

At an apparent magnitude of +10.02, HIP 23309 is a faint star that requires a telescope to observe. It is invisible to the naked eye and too dim for most binoculars. Observers will note its orange h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.297.
